A data governance framework is an effective tool for ensuring the reliability, integrity, and accessibility of enterprise data. It can help to ensure regulatory compliance and safeguard your organizations assets from cyber-attacks, unauthorized access, data breaches, and theft.
Developing a practical framework requires the right people, processes, and technology. Here are 5 Key Elements of an Effective Data Governance Framework to guide your strategy:
Define Your Objectives
Before you embark on a data governance framework, setting your objectives is essential. This will help ensure the process is successful and grows as your business evolves.
Defining your objectives will also help you identify and prioritize your stakeholders. These might include data owners, users, and auditors.
Youll need a team of people to implement your framework, so consider assembling a mix of data security specialists, IT professionals, project managers, and subject matter experts. You can also round out the group with employees with frontline experience who understand your data strategy and how it affects business operations.
When building your team, think big-picture but start small. Getting everyone on board with your vision will help make the process successful.

Define Your Scope
Defining your scope will help you to build a data governance framework that works for your organization. It will portray your strategy, policies, and measures to ensure that all stakeholders are on the same page and that data is trusted, well-documented, and easy to find within your organization.
Leaders in every industry know that to thrive, they need readily available, high-quality, and relevant data. Without these characteristics, digital transformation, analytics, and new sources of revenue cannot drive business success.
When creating a data governance program, leaders in this space often start by understanding the organizations unique business drivers. These may include regulatory compliance and industry mandates, such as health insurance privacy laws.
Leading organizations also use metrics to measure the impact of their governance efforts. These can include data scientists time finding, enabling, or curating data for priority use cases or the dollar losses that poor-quality data results in.
These metrics allow leaders in this space to demonstrate the value creation their data-governance activities have generated. They can help to ensure that governance efforts will continue to receive the attention of top management.
Defining your policies is one of the essential elements of a practical data governance framework. It will help you create a roadmap and set your objectives while also enabling you to standardize roles and processes.
The policies you set should align with your business goals, ensuring that you provide the best data possible to your organization and maintain regulatory compliance. These policies should also cover data quality, security, and privacy.
It would help if you also considered whether your data governance model is best suited for the size and structure of your company. For instance, if you are a large enterprise, it might be better to implement an end-to-end approach that includes policies, rules, and guidelines.
Once you have defined your policies, it is time to begin implementing them at your company. This process can be challenging, but following the steps above gives you an excellent foundation to build your data governance framework. You can start with a small sample size to assess the state of your data, then expand from there.

Define Your Metrics
A practical data governance framework is crucial to any organization that collects and stores information from different sources. It helps ensure data is accurate and readily accessible, improving productivity and boosting overall business performance.
A successful data governance strategy also requires a clear set of metrics that can be used to measure its success. These metrics can include the number of workers trained in the new system, improvements in productivity, and stakeholder satisfaction, among others.
The most important aspect of defining metrics for a practical data governance framework is to think with the big picture in mind. Getting caught up in detail and straying from the goal is easy.
A well-defined set of metrics will help you monitor progress and make necessary adjustments if needed. They can also provide a roadmap for how you plan to achieve your goals. In addition, theyre an excellent way to communicate with your team and stakeholders.
